What are the must-see historical sites and other places to visit in Downtown St. George?
Downtown St. George is notable for landmarks like St. George Tabernacle, Brigham Young Winter Home and Pioneer Courthouse Museum. Cultural venues include St. George Art Museum, St. George Musical Theater and McQuarrie Memorial Pioneer Museum. A couple of additional sights to add to your itinerary are Greater Zion Stadium and St. George Children's Museum.

What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
"Heritage hotel" is more common in Asia and Europe, wheareas the term "historic hotel" is more commonly used in the U.S. but overall the terms are quite similar. The architecture and building of a historic hotel tends to be the most important aspect. For a heritage hotel, it's often the cultural value and how it shaped the community.
